New Directions Education are currently recruiting for Level 1, 2 and 3 Teaching Assistants to work in secondary schools across the Flintshire borough.
The work available is to start immediately, and the shifts available are varied and flexible. We are able to offer full or part time hours, and the hours of work are term time only, worked between 08.50am – 3.30pm.
You are able to state the areas of Flintshire that you can travel to, your preferred hours of work and age groups that you would feel more comfortable with.
Experience working as a Level 1 Teaching Assistant is desirable, but not essential. We have the opportunity to register Trainee Teaching Assistants, but ask that you have experience working with children, coaching or within the care sector. We can offer support and training.
